Haw. Code R. § 14-25.1-2 - Filing of appeal
(a) Any person who
has exhausted all internal complaint procedures and who has standing to appeal
shall appeal to the board in the following manner:
(1) An appeal by an applicant on a
recruitment, examination, or suitability for employment matter, or by an
initial probationary employee, who has been determined to have failed initial
probation, shall be filed with the merit appeals board within twenty days from
the date on the notification from the director or appointing
authority.
(2) An appeal by an
employee on matters relating to the classification and reclassification of a
particular position shall be filed with the merit appeals board within thirty
days after the date of the notice of final action by the director or appointing
authority.
(3) An appeal by an
employee on matters relating to the initial pricing of classes shall be filed
with the merit appeals board within thirty days after the date of the notice of
final action by the director.
(4)
An appeal by an employee on an employment action as provided by section
14-25.1-1(b)(4), shall be filed with the merit appeals board within thirty days
after notice of final action by the director or appointing authority.
(b) Any appeal must be filed in
the manner prescribed by the board and in compliance with the requirements
specified in section 14-22.1-5.
